Buongiorno,

nel configurare un link in etherchannel su uno Switch Catalyst2960 in modalità active verso un Server ho notato che non mi viene segnalato quale porta sta funzionando e dove sta passando il carico (vedi le due righe in grassetto alla fine dell'ultimo comando di show). Il link aggregation è up e la scheda virtuale del server mi indica correttamente un flusso a 2GB, deduco che l'etherchannel è configurato correttamente (anche perché tutto funziona). Il channel-group è il 4 e le porte che ne fanno parte sono la gigabit1/0/46 e la gigabit2/0/46
Allego qualche show:

Dunque, dal tuo output si direbbe che il traffico passante sul portchannel 4 sia nullo, infatti leggendo le ultime righe dello show etherchannel portchannel si vede:

Index Load Port EC state No of bits
+
+
+
+
0 00 Gi1/0/46 Active 0
0 00 Gi2/0/46 Active 0

che sostanzialmente vuol dire che le due porte del channel hanno carico a zero.

Puoi anche utilizzare il comando show etherchannel port per avere informazioni sulla distribuzione del carico.

In ogni caso ti consiglio di generare traffico e successivamente verificare come viene distribuito il traffico passante sul port-channel

Paolo_Tesse ha scritto: con il comando
show spanning-tree
da cosa dipende il costo del link etherchannel?

Dalla speed negoziata sulle porte secondo la tabella dei costi spanning-tree. Quindi tiene conto della velocità reale dell'ehterchannel
